SAN FRANCISCO — The Latest on a San Francisco police officer shot after exchanging gunfire with a suspect (all times local):7:30 p.m.San Francisco police say a shootout that sent schoolchildren ducking for cover wounded one officer, the suspected gunman and four others, including a minor. San Francisco General Hospital spokesman Brent Andrew says the officer is in fair condition. The San Francisco Chronicle reported that the officer and a suspect were each shot in the leg during a shootout at about 4:20 p.m. The officer was being treated at the Zuckerberg San Francisco General Hospital. Authorities say a San Francisco police officer has been shot while responding to an incident in the city’s Mission district.
